Out for a Swim

Childrens pool is part of La Jolla Cove
What was once a protected cove for young children to swim in, is now a 
protected cove for children of another species to swim in.

After a long battle to protect the sea lions who breed there and live there year round, finally they were allowed to stay.  I for one think that this decision not only served the Sea Lions but it also served the children who used to swim there.  It has become a nature preserve where children and adults can come a view nature first hand.  Like this baby seal taking his first swim with Dad resting on the beach and Mom right behind him.

Another Day in Paradise

Crystal Blue waters, caves, and rocky formations jut out of the sea .  A brown pelican perches on the cliff he was born on.  This is the nesting area for the California brown pelican that was once on the endangered species list but thanks to protective areas for breeding, their population has increased and their future looks good.

Big Splash

Childrens pool at La Jolla Cove, Ca.  A breakwater walkway protects this tiny cove from the big waves crashing in on the beach.  It is the perfect site for the Sea Lions to breed and raise their babies.

Is Man in Nature's world or is Nature in Man's World?

This is the question that I ask myself today.

Our population of White Swans are diminishing here at the Lake. They haven't had offspring in several years.  Being new to the Lake I was curious about this.  What happened yesterday answered all my questions.

I live in a well manicured lake community.  We love it here, the lake is gorgeous and the waterfowl the visit here are amazing.  Those that breed here are in danger though.  We have taken away all their safe breeding areas by removing the brush and manicuring the lawns all the way to the water so that we could have a better view of the lake.  The poor Swans don't have the material they need to make their nests and the certainly don't have brush to hide their nests from predators.

© Copyright  2012-2017 Carrera Fine Art Photography, All Right Reserved, All Photographs and Digital Art on this website are Copyright protected. The copyright act protects photographers and artists by giving the artist of the photograph the exclusive right to copy, edit, and distribute imagery for sale or transfer. These exclusive rights make it illegal to copy, scan, edit, or share photographic prints and digital art without the photographers permission. Violators of the Federal Law will be subject to it's civil and criminal penalties. Be sure to discuss your copyright needs with your photographer; reasonable requests may be accommodated. Many of the photographs can be licensed allowing you to use them in magazines, websites, Blogs, and advertisements, but you must purchase the license from the artist first.
